On Wed, Aug 1, 2012 at 6:29 PM, József Makay <[email protected]> wrote: > Hi! Hi József, > > Now I've received a reminder mail from the kde-maillist. Why is my password > on the bottom of this mail? Do you not hash the passwords? It' not safe, > very very not. We use Mailman as our mailing list software, which unfortunately keeps plaintext passwords at this time. Please see https://mail.kde.org/mailman/listinfo/kde-artists for the warning notice regarding this. Quote: "You may enter a privacy password below. This provides only mild security, but should prevent others from messing with your subscription. Do not use a valuable password as it will occasionally be emailed back to you in cleartext. ".
